In a potentiometer experiment, the balancing length with a resistance of 2Ω is found to be 100 cm, while that of an unknown resistance is 500 cm. Calculate the value of the unknown resistance.
Advertisements
उत्तर
`R = 2 Ω`
`l_R = 100 "cm"`
`X = ?`
`l_X = 500 "cm"`
`therefore` by balancing bridge condition
`R/X = l_R/l_Y`
`2/X = 100/500`
`X = 10 Ω`
